## Runbook: Replacing the Ledgewick Job Queue

We are retiring the homegrown Ledgewick queue in favor of the Asterholm broker. Drain Ledgewick first: disable enqueue, let workers empty the backlog, then snapshot the dead-letter table. Only then cut producers over. Keep the old daemon installed for one release cycle as a rollback path. The migration build is identified by the token below.

build token for kagaf-hahof: htk14_9d3d4d26d7d8de

Subject: Quickstore 4.2 — bloom filter now fronts the KV layer

Plugin authors: starting with this release, Quickstore places a bloom filter ahead of the key-value store. Negative lookups return faster; false positives fall through safely. No API changes are required on your side. Verify your plugin against the staging build referenced below.

session token of fahif-tadup = htk3_9c7

Minutes — Management Meeting, Varnell Instruments
Attendees reviewed pricing for the Clarion gauge line. Margin analysis showed the mid-tier model underperforming target by four points, largely due to component costs from the Tellwick facility. Ms. Orantes proposed a phased list-price increase of 3% in two stages, with distributor rebates held flat. The committee agreed to model elasticity before final approval and to revisit bundling options for the Clarion Pro. The board should note the following plan.

confidential, hahop-bajep: Gross margin on Ralath came in at 5 percent against a plan of 10 percent. Only 9 of the 100 pilot accounts renewed Ralath, so a churn review is set for April 1.

Quick rundown for the team: the new commission scheme for Velloran Systems reps kicked in last month, and early numbers look decent. Payouts are now tiered against margin rather than raw bookings, which has nudged the field away from discount-heavy deals on the Castellan suite. Total commission expense is tracking about 4% under the old model, though the Hadleybrook region is grumbling about thresholds. We'll revisit accruals at quarter-end. How this feeds the wider plan is captured in the confidential note below.

internal memo for kaguf-yajog: Headcount on the Druath team goes from 30 to 70 by the end of November. Gross margin on Druath came in at 56 percent against a plan of 28 percent.